    Linda G.

    Went at lunchtime on a Saturday - seated right away, staff was attentive and friendly. Busy place, a little noisy but we didn't find it a problem. Lots of tall comfortable booths and everything was very clean. We ordered off the breakfast menu and our food tasted great! Big portions, scrambled eggs cooked perfectly and nice thick toast. Enjoyed our visit - would definitely return

    Colleen F.

    Stopped here after reading some reviews as we were in the area for a business trip. Quick service to be seated and order our food. Our waitress was fairly attentive and highly recommended a few things on the menu. Portions were a good size and food was good. Price for two people was reasonable too. Menu was huge and a bit overwhelming. Would probably be a good place for breakfast.

    I've never ordered food in person here but I've done several Uber Eats orders, all of which have consisted of good quality breakfast. The Angel's Omelette (I think that's what it's called) is excellent and consists of bacon, mushrooms, onions, and more. I always get that whenever I order from here. I do find the home fries that come with the omelette a bit too starchy. Other than that though, I happily continue to order from here again and again, especially considering the prices here are quite reasonable.

    Fortune M.

    I came here with my friend and her little girl for breakfast. We both had the Eggs Bennie, and her daughter just got a side order of bacon and was going to have some of the fruit that came with our meal. At first, I thought the prices were a bit much, but when our meal came, I changed my mind. Her daughter's side order of bacon was a huge plate full. My Eggs Bennie was not only delicious, but the serving size was huge, and I couldn't even eat some of the large fruit bowl, so I gave the rest to her daughter. It had kiwi and raspberries and bananas and cantaloupe and pineapple. So great!

    Mo H.

    Mediocre of the mediocre.... --- Food --- Pricing of food can be ok I suppose, but no specials that blow me away. The fruit boat, unlike a previous review, was not a mountain of fruit. It was a small portion, and for 4.99, not something I would purchase again. The chicken sandwich was surprisingly a little above average. The chicken is whole instead of parts, and is grilled instead of fried. The vegetables were good and the goat cheese sauce was mediocre. --- Coffee --- Absolute garbage. How can you run a breakfast place, and serve cold, watered down coffee. It was not brought hot, so what's the point of even bringing it.. --- Service --- Well. Normally I'm not this harsh but I guess I'll break that. This place is staffed by older women and kids. It seems to be family run, hard to tell, other than the blatant indentured servitude of the poor kids that seemingly hate their job. I understand employing your kid if they want to, but this place seems like the place to employ a kid and then say "sure well pay you but also you owe us rent equal to what we are paying you". --- Overall --- I will not be returning here. Only reason its not a 1 star is because the chicken sandwich was above average for some reason.

    Robert S.

    I have just had (arguably) the best breakfast in my life. No joke, it was that good and it was cheap. For $6.49, I got an extremely delicious breakfast of 3 eggs, 5 pieces of bacon, pan fried potatoes, 2 slices of toast and an orange slice. The breakfast menu here is quite extensive. Looking forward to my trip back to London and especially to Angel's in January.
